Ir para conteúdo
  • Cadastre-se

dev botao

CoInitialize não foi chamado, ClassID: {91D221C4-0CD4-461C-A728-01D509321556}


julio_cld
Ver Solução Respondido por julio_cld,
  • Este tópico foi criado há 1403 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Bom dia!

Gostaria de sanar uma dúvida.

Baixei o repositório recentemente, instalei novamente os componentes ACBr.

Estou tentando transmitir um CTe, ambiente de homologação.

estou com o seguinte erro: CoInitialize não foi chamado, ClassID: {91D221C4-0CD4-461C-A728-01D509321556}.

Estou utilizando a configuração libCapicom.

Esse tipo de configuração não funciona mais para emissão dos documentos eletrônicos?

Link para o comentário
Compartilhar em outros sites

  • Moderadores

verifique se o no ACBr.inc ou no instalador não está com a opção para desabilitar o capicom ligado ou senão tem outro acbr.inc no seu projeto

Consultor SAC ACBr Juliomar Marchetti
 

Projeto ACBr

skype: juliomar
telegram: juliomar
e-mail: [email protected]
http://www.juliomarmarchetti.com.br
MVP_NewLogo_100x100_Black-02.png
 

 

Link para o comentário
Compartilhar em outros sites

  • Moderadores
6 horas atrás, julio_cld disse:

Testei exemplo de CTe. Não apresentou erro no método assinar apenas no meu aplicativo. 

na linha abaixo 

Unit ACBrCTeConhecimentos

linha 246

    if not Assigned(SSL.AntesDeAssinar) then
      SSL.ValidarCNPJCertificado( CTe.Emit.CNPJ );
 

Está implementando algo no evento "OnAntesDeAssinar"?

Equipe ACBr BigWings
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

 

 

Link para o comentário
Compartilhar em outros sites

7 minutos atrás, BigWings disse:

Está implementando algo no evento "OnAntesDeAssinar"?

Não, a propriedade FAntesDeAssinar é instanciada no create da classe TDFeSSL  = nil

 logo é executado a função SSL.ValidarCNPJCertificado (onde é ocasionado o problema)

isolei a linha da função acima para não validar o CNPJ com o cert. digital e validou e emitiu o CTe normalmente.


 

Link para o comentário
Compartilhar em outros sites

  • Solution

Bom dia pessoal!

Hoje pela manhã, efetuei novos testes (emissão de CTe e MDFe) e advinha!

Tudo funcionando (fontes originais do ACBr sem nenhuma alteração), não tenho explicações para ocorrido.

Gostaria de fechar o tópico e agradecer pela ajuda de todos.

Link para o comentário
Compartilhar em outros sites

  • Este tópico foi criado há 1403 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.
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.